    Tender documentation for renno/additions project?

    Spec, then drawings Drawings are good, and tell you where to put things, but in order of tender documents priority, they are number 2. Number 1 is the specification. This should layout every item that you want a price on, also how you expect it to be finished and what Australian standards...

    The cost of using a draftsman service

    Im going to weigh in on this discussions and dispel a few urban myths. First off, I am an architect. Architects generally charge on a percentage of the cost of construction, and this will vary according to the cost of the job and the prestige of the designer. (the higher the build cost=the...
